Joint ownerships are taxed via income attribution rather than Corporate Tax

The applicant inquired whether a joint ownership (comunidad de bienes) dedicated to sports facilities is liable for Corporate Tax. The DGT ruled that, as a joint ownership, it continues to be taxed through the attribution of income to its members.

How it affects those involved

This confirms that joint ownerships do not acquire corporate tax liability despite their commercial activities, maintaining their status for income attribution purposes.
